#!/usr/bin/env python3
"""
Setup configuration for VelocityCMDB
Traditional setup.py approach for PyPI packaging.
Works with MANIFEST.in for file inclusion.
"""
from setuptools import setup, find_packages
from pathlib import Path
import os
# Read version from velocitycmdb/__init__.py or cli.py
VERSION = "0.11.6"
# Read README for long description
readme_path = Path(__file__).parent / "README.md"
if readme_path.exists():
with open(readme_path, 'r', encoding='utf-8', errors='ignore') as f:
long_description = f.read()
else:
long_description = "Tactical network CMDB with automated discovery, change detection, and operational intelligence"
# Read requirements
requirements_path = Path(__file__).parent / "requirements.txt"
requirements = []
if requirements_path.exists():
with open(requirements_path, 'r', encoding='utf-8') as f:
requirements = [
line.strip()
for line in f
if line.strip() and not line.startswith("#")
]
setup(
name="velocitycmdb",
version=VERSION,
author="Scott Peterman",
author_email="scottpeterman@gmail.com",
description="Tactical network CMDB with automated discovery, change detection, and operational intelligence",
long_description=long_description,
long_description_content_type="text/markdown",
url="https://github.com/scottpeterman/velocitycmdb",
project_urls={
"Documentation": "https://github.com/scottpeterman/velocitycmdb/blob/main/README.md",
"Source": "https://github.com/scottpeterman/velocitycmdb",
"Tracker": "https://github.com/scottpeterman/velocitycmdb/issues",
},
# Find all packages under velocitycmdb/
packages=find_packages(exclude=['tests', 'tests.*', 'docs']),
# Classifiers for PyPI
classifiers=[
"Development Status :: 4 - Beta",
"Intended Audience :: System Administrators",
"Intended Audience :: Information Technology",
"Topic :: System :: Networking",
"Topic :: System :: Networking :: Monitoring",
"Topic :: System :: Systems Administration",
"License :: OSI Approved :: MIT License",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3.10",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3.11",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3.12",
"Operating System :: OS Independent",
"Environment :: Web Environment",
"Framework :: Flask",
],
# Python version requirement
python_requires=">=3.10",
# Core dependencies
install_requires=requirements,
# Package data - files to include in the package
# MANIFEST.in handles the actual file selection
package_data={
"velocitycmdb": [
# Flask templates and static files
"app/templates/**/*.html",
"app/static/**/*.*",
"app/static/**/**/*.*",
# TextFSM templates database
"pcng/tfsm_templates.db",
"pcng/command_templates.json",
# Job definition files
"pcng/jobs/*.json",
# Database schema files (if you have them)
"db/schema/*.sql",
],
},
# Include files specified in MANIFEST.in
include_package_data=True,
# CLI entry points
# This creates the 'velocitycmdb' command that calls cli.py:main()
entry_points={
"console_scripts": [
"velocitycmdb=velocitycmdb.cli:main",
],
},
# Optional dependencies
# Install with: pip install velocitycmdb[ldap]
# Note: LDAP is actually included in base install, these are true extras
extras_require={
"windows": [
# Windows-specific packages (automatically excluded on other platforms)
"pywin32>=311",
"WMI>=1.5.1",
],
"linux": [
# Linux-specific packages (for PAM authentication)
"python-pam>=2.0.2",
],
"all": [
# All optional features with platform markers
"pywin32>=311; sys_platform == 'win32'",
"WMI>=1.5.1; sys_platform == 'win32'",
"python-pam>=2.0.2; sys_platform == 'linux'",
],
"dev": [
# Development and testing tools
"pytest>=7.0.0",
"pytest-cov>=4.0.0",
"black>=23.0.0",
"flake8>=6.0.0",
"mypy>=1.0.0",
],
"docs": [
# Documentation generation
"sphinx>=5.0.0",
"sphinx-rtd-theme>=1.2.0",
],
},
# Keywords for PyPI search
keywords=[
"network", "cmdb", "discovery", "monitoring",
"cisco", "arista", "juniper", "netbox", "automation",
"network-management", "configuration-management",
"network-discovery", "lldp", "cdp", "textfsm"
],
# Don't create a zip file
zip_safe=False,
)
print(f"\nVelocityCMDB v{VERSION} setup complete!")
print("\nAfter installation, run:")
print(" velocitycmdb init # Initialize data directory and databases")
print(" velocitycmdb run # Start web interface")
